A bunch of channels have disappeared -- it now goes straight from 1 to 12. There's no TV2, TV3 etc.
Please fix
Maybe removing the power, and rebooting the box.
The fix for missing channels is to hide then unhide the pay channels or around the other way.
menu, settings, content settings, unsubscribed channels, show or hide
Apsattv:
The fix for missing channels is to hide then unhide the pay channels or around the other way.
Ok, that worked thanks. Lame bug

@21brandon21 It sounds like if you are not using a fixed IP address for VTV, which does not get managed by DHCP (i.e. is not in the range of DHCP addresses), you may have a DHCP problem. I suggest you reboot your router and if this does not help login to to the router admin screen and check the IP address assigned to the VTV, and check that you have spare DHCP addresses to issue and do not have over 32 devices active if you have a Huaewi HG659 or HG659B router.
